The Formation of Rock Salt in Geology
The main ingredient of rock salt, sometimes referred to as halite, is sodium chloride (NaCl), which is also present in table salt. Its origins can be traced to prehistoric geological eras in which large inland seas or saltwater lakes evaporated, leaving behind dense salt crystal formations. These deposits were compressed and turned into solid rock salt formations throughout time as a result of being buried beneath sedimentary layers.
Water gradually evaporates during the production of rock salt, leaving behind dissolved minerals. The concentration of dissolved salts rises with evaporation until it reaches a saturation point. Salt crystals start to separate from the fluid at this phase and gather near the lake or sea’s bottom. Thick layers of rock salt are created when salt crystals continue to accumulate over long periods of time.
Rock Salt Mining and Extraction
The two main techniques used to remove rock salt are usually solution mining and underground mining. Miners use horizontal tunnels or vertical shafts to reach the rock salt deposits during underground mining. After cutting and extracting the salt with specialised machinery, it is brought to the surface for additional processing. In contrast, solution mining dissolves the salt in the rock by pumping water into the formation. After that, the brine is pumped to the top, where the water evaporates and leaves behind crystals of pure salt.
Numerous Uses for Rock Salt
Because of its availability and adaptability, rock salt is a vital resource for a wide range of uses and industries.
Winter road maintenance and de-icing: During the winter, clearing snow from driveways, sidewalks and roads is one of the most popular applications for rock salt. Spreading rock salt on snowy surfaces lowers the freezing point of water, inhibiting the creation of new ice and melting that which already exists. This contributes to increased traction and safer driving circumstances.
Food business: Another important application for rock salt is in the food business. In a variety of culinary items, it serves as a texture modifier, flavour enhancer, and preservative. Rock salt imparts a unique flavour and extends the shelf life of food in a variety of applications, including pickling vegetables and curing meats, as well as improving baked products.
Water softening: High mineral content hard water can lead to a number of issues, such as scaling in appliances and pipes, dry skin and hair, and trouble lathering soap. In water softening systems, rock salt is utilised to eliminate the calcium and magnesium ions that cause hard water. In order to provide a steady supply of soft water, the salt in the water softener regenerates the resin beads.
Rock salt is a necessary mineral supplement for cattle and poultry in agriculture and animal feed. It offers salt and chloride, two essential electrolytes that balance body processes and preserve general health. In agriculture, rock salt is also used to suppress weeds and increase soil fertility.
Applications in Industry: A variety of industrial processes employ rock salt. It is employed in the synthesis of several compounds, including caustic soda and chlorine. In addition, rock salt finds application in the oil and gas sector as drilling fluid and in the textile business for fabric finishing and dyeing.

Environmental Aspects to Take into Account
Even though rock salt has several advantages, it’s vital to think about any possible environmental effects. Overuse of rock salt for de-icing can contaminate water and soil, which can harm aquatic life and plant growth. In environmentally sensitive places, it is imperative to use rock salt sparingly and investigate other de-icing options, such as sand or calcium chloride.
